Stock market update: Stocks that hit 52-week lows on NSE in today's trade

Titan Company, Dr. Reddys, Cipla, Bajaj Auto and Trent were among the top losers on NSE in today's trade.

Agencies
India 10-year bond yield rose 0.37 per cent to 6 after trading in 5.99-6.01 range.
NEW DELHI: Nectar Lifesc, PVP Ventures Ltd., Sadhana Nitro, Creative Peripherals and Anisha Impex and others were among the stocks that touched their 52-week lows in today's trade.

Domestic benchmark index NSE Nifty ended 61.21 points up at 25522.5, while the BSE Sensex closed 270.01 points up at 83712.51.

On the other hand, Sambhv Steel Tubes, Belrise Industries, Parsvnath Dev., Gabriel India and Ellenbarrie Ind. Gas stocks hit their fresh 52-week highs today.


In the Nifty 50 index, Kotak Bank, Eternal, Asian Paints, NTPC and Grasim Inds. were among the top gainers on the NSE in the today's trade.

Meanwhile, Titan Company, Dr. Reddys, Cipla, Bajaj Auto and Trent were among the top losers of the day.
